Output 56a570faa20af23ac8542e4fcdf16c8d6ba472c19bfaa27e9f18c1152f1c6191:0

value
3682910
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1389bf95fe2c248b8765534f73c5cf490a0a025a OP_EQUALVERIFY OP_CHECKSIG
address
12nJra568HFQTgTRz27FmJg9NKWLyQU2FV
transaction
56a570faa20af23ac8542e4fcdf16c8d6ba472c19bfaa27e9f18c1152f1c6191
spent
true